DEVELOPMENT OF AIRLINE TYPE PRECISION VOR RECEIVER SYSTEM, PVOR(M).

Abstract

The objective was to design and produce an engineering model aircraft navigation receiver system to be used for testing the Multilobe Precision VHF Omnirange system, PVOR(M). To assure optimum reliability and stability of the receiver system, the most advanced techniques were employed. The receiver system consists of a modified airline-type VHF navigation receiver and a modified Course Deviation Indicator/Omni Bearing Selector (CDI/OBS) instrument. The modified receiver system permits reception and display of multilobe precision VOR signals as well as the conventional VOR and Localizer signals described in ARINC Characteristic No. 547.
